MOVIE(*.avi/*.Divx) supporting file Video format : MPEG1 , MPEG2, MPEG4 (Doesn't support Microsoft MPEG4-V2, V3), DivX 3.xx , DivX 4.xx, DivX 5.xx , DivX VOD ( DRM ), XviD, DivX 6.xx(Playback) Audio format : Mpeg, Mp3, PCM, Dolby Digital Sampling frequency : ... in the USB folder and supports Play. Extension name mpg, mpeg, mpe, vob, dat Avi, divx, m4v Video Codec MPEG1, MPEG2 MPEG4-SP, MPEG4-ASP, DivX 3.xx, DivX 4.xx, DivX 5.xx, DivX 6.xx(Playback), Xvid Audio Codec AC3, MPEG, MP3, PCM AC3, MPEG, MP3, PCM Resolution ...
